The Model 4455 Digital RF Receiver is a state-of-the-art receiver that provides: a compact, cost competitive, flexible solution to a wide variety of communications link scenarios. The 1U Rack Mountable Chassis is available in a dual channel configuration with diversity combiner. Each channel is completely independent and is able to acquire on three (3) RF Bands: S Band; Upper L Band, Lower L Band, and optional C Band or P (CIF) Band. Other Multi-Band options are available.

The demodulation process, as well as the baseband bit synchronization process, is totally performed in the digital domain. Signal acquisition is performed by scanning the IF within the programmed acquisition band centered about the selected Carrier frequency. The Input Waveform is additionally scanned for acquisition at the subcarrier frequencies. Once signal acquisition is complete, synchronized signal tracking is performed whereby continuous validation of the lock state is maintained.

typical-channel-chartLINK IMPROVEMENTS & NOISE MITIGATION
A variety of optional FEC decoders are available and two fully programmable frame synchronizers (pattern detection) are provided with the bit synchronizer option. The MD4455 receiver can specifically be configured to mitigate noisy/congested environments through the use of

  • Low Density Parity Check (LDPC*) coding to improve link margin while using less bandwidth,
  • Adaptive Equalization (AEQ*) to mitigate multipath distortion.
  • Advanced Diversity Combiner Functions (AGC & Data Quality) for superior performance in the presence of multi-path

An Encapsulated data and data-quality output may be included that supports the GDP Best Source Selector products. RCC DQE/DQM is also supported.

NETWORK DIRECT MODE!
The MD4455 Receiver can optionally be configured to accept your IRIG Chapter 7* downlink, bit/Frame synchronize and output your IRIG Chapter 10/11* UDP packet to your favorite Analysis package or our Acroamatics Decoms or Wideband Network recorder simultaneously. IRIG 218-2010 & 2010 can also be accommodated directly. UDP/IP transport is provided for raw data or byte aligned data output.

INPUT:

RF Frequency                       LL, UL, LS, US, and C Bands – see features on page

Noise Figure                      < 8 dB Max, 4 dB typ.

IF Filters                             Selectable filter bandwidths (Standard set provided)

Dynamic Range                   > 90 dB

Input Impedance                50 Ohms

VSWR                                     < 2:1

 

DEMODULATION:

IF Acquisition / Tracking Range         >± 255 kHz

Loop Bandwidth                                      0.01% to 1% of Bit Rate (Analog PM 2 Hz to 20 kHz)

PM Demodulator

Frequency Response                     100 Hz to 20 MHz

Modulation Index                          0 to 3.0 Radians

PM Demodulator

Frequency Response                     100 Hz to 20 MHz

Modulation Index                          0.5 to >100%

Deemphasis                                     NTSC/PAL

PSK Demodulators

Types                                                  1 IF, 2 SC *

Modulation Waveforms                 BPSK, QPSK, OQPSK, AUQPSK *, GMSK *, SOQOSK (ARTM Tier 1)

Locking Threshold                          6 dB Eb/No

PCM/FM Demodulator (ARTM Tier 0)

Data Rate                                         10 bps to 10 Mbps– Standard  (20 Mbps *)

Multi-h CPM (ARTM Tier 2)*                100Kbps to 40 Mbps

Space Time Code (STC)*                         100kbps to 40Mbps

8PSK*/16APSK*                                        100kbps to 40Mbps

 

BIT SYNCHRONIZER(S)

Bit Rate                                  50 bps to 10 Mbps PCM/FM & BPSK (20 Mbps *)

100 bps to 20 Mbps QPSK/SOQPSK (40 Mbps *)

Input Codes                          NRZ-L/M/S; Biϴ-L/M/S, RNRZ (Other codes available as needed)*

Output Codes                      NRZ-L/M/S; Biϴ-L/M/S, RNRZ (Other codes available as needed)*

Decoders *                             Viterbi Rate 1/2, 2/3*, 3/4*, 7/8* ; Reed Solomon*, Concatenated*, LDPC* 1/2, 2/3, 4/5, 7/8

Derandomizer/Descrambler                                                  IRIG/CCSDS/V.35 / V.36 (CCITT/ Intelsat)

 

DATA OUTPUT

Analog

TTL, RS422

Ethernet Data Output  (IRIG 218*, IRIG-106 Ch-10*, HDLC/AX.25*)

Encapsulated Data & Data Quality that supports GDP & IRIG Best Source Selector *

 

CONTROL INTERFACE:
Ethernet (Standard)

 

ENVIRONMENT:
Temperature 10°C to 40°C Operational; -40°C to 70°C Storage (Extended Temperature Ranges available)

 

STATUS OUTPUT:

Signal Level, Freq Offset, BS Lock, BS Eb/No, FEC Lock, FS Lock, Phase Deviation, Composite Lock, AGC, Carrier Lock, Demod Lock, EQ Cntrl, ERO MDO, Code Word Count, Corrected Count, Decode Fail Count

 

*OPTIONAL
